The Role
Would you like to be part of a successful and rewarding business? Dreams and Sofatime are experiencing a substantial period of growth and are seeking a Part Time Power BI Report Writer to join our expanding team. In this role, you will play a key part in transforming data into meaningful insights that support operational excellence and help drive strategic decision-making across the business.
Main Accountabilities
- Design, develop and maintain Power BI dashboards, reports and data models to support business decision-making.
- Convert existing reports into Power BI and improve data visualisation standards across the Company.
- Work with stakeholders to gather reporting requirements and deliver high-quality, accurate outputs.
- Ensure data accuracy, integrity and security across all reporting solutions.
- Support teams across the organisation by providing insight, training and guidance on Power BI usage.
- Monitor report performance, troubleshoot issues and implement enhancements where necessary.
- Assist in shaping best practices for reporting, visualisation and data governance.
- Uphold high standards of documentation, version control and data compliance.
Essential & Desirable Criteria
- Experience using Microsoft Power BI.
- Strong analytical, problem-solving and data manipulation skills.
- Ability to interpret data and present insights in a clear and engaging manner.
- Excellent communication skills with the ability to translate complex data into understandable insights.
- Experience with SQL, Excel or other data analysis tools.
- Experience converting legacy reports into Power BI.
- Knowledge of Power BI Service, data gateways and data refresh processes.
